A-Cell®
A-Cell® is a licensed extra cellular matrix (ECM) currently being utilized as an agent to promote tissue reconstruction. ECM’s have been derived from several tissues in human research and this A-Cell product is derived specifically from the submucosa of porcine urinary bladder. It is proving to be very effective in promoting tissue regeneration and return to function of tendon and ligament injuries in the equine limb. Cases involving acute or chronic suspensory ligament injuries have been especially rewarding both in obtaining stronger, more organized fiber pattern healing on ultrasound and in returning to rehabilitation exercise and performance more rapidly than previous therapies. Treatment is accomplished by intra-lesional injection of the A-Cell suspension followed by an exacting post treatment therapy and exercise program.
Other ancillary therapeutic modalities which we are currently utilizing in conjunction with A-Cell® include autologous washed platelets, bone marrow, adipose-origin stem cells, and Tildren ®. Each of these components of therapy has specific functions in tissue healing and fiber repair, and their applicability are assessed on an individual case basis. The end result, however, has been a dramatic enhancement of tendon-ligament repair process on a cellular level, a marked decrease in the time required to rehabilitate and return to performance (as much as 30-50% decrease), a better prognosis for return to upper level performance stress, and a decrease in incidence of injury site reoccurrence.
